Capital Fund Management (CFM)'s Q4 2019 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2019, Capital Fund Management (CFM) held 2,123 positions worth $12.7B, up 14% from $11.1B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 8.4% of the portfolio.

Capital Fund Management (CFM) deployed $651M of net new capital in Q4 2019, opening 503 new positions and adding to 607 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Costco: 138,536 shares worth $40.7M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 7.3% of assets, down from 11%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Financials.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Microsoft, an estimated $74.8M trimmed.
